New NEC laptops issue you a Face Pass

NEC laptop has face pass recognition securityImproved security for your computer is all the rage these days and NEC is out to impress you (and attain your patronage) by going the facial recognition route. The company has just announced plans to bring out two new laptop lines for the Japanese market that integrate NEC’s “Face Pass” technology to keep strangers out of your files.


The LaVie C and LaVie L series use the laptop’s 2.0 megapixel camera and its NeoFace software to recognize your mug when you try and log on to the machine. NeoFace can ascertain the physical differences between your face and someone else’s by measuring the distance from your eyes to specific features on your face.
